Output 64ae588c8fb92f509781bc7a78eb0e07db668894d7d01b186dc4887deabbdd09:7

value
4030903606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bae73f2871243bd8f9e27a0dac726d9890fcd142 OP_EQUAL
address
3JjGdXYHx1hLbLUjfkHugvH4YVvuTeeU5B
transaction
64ae588c8fb92f509781bc7a78eb0e07db668894d7d01b186dc4887deabbdd09
spent
true